Doctor Who Vs. Carry On Again Doctor

The eighteenth production
(and the third with a medical 
theme) from the Carry On
stable was released in 1969,
and again starred franchise
stalwarts Sid James, Kenneth
Williams, Charles Hawtrey,
 Joan Sims, Hattie Jacques,
Barbara Windsor, and Peter
Butterworth. Patsy Rowlands
 (1931-2005) debuted here,
and starred in eight further
titles, whilst Jim Dale made his final series appearance until Carry On
Columbus (1992). This comedy, the sequel to 1968's Carry On Doctor,
was shown on ITV3 today - it featured twenty-four Doctor Who cast
connections:

  • Donald [Harold Gunn] Bisset (Patient) was Colin McLaren in The Highlanders
  • Faith Kent (Matron) voiced Maven for Big Finish's Omega (2003)
  • for William Mervyn see Follow That Camel
  • Claire [Bernice] Davenport (Guest here; Blonde in Carry On Emmannuelle) was the Empress in (episode 7 of) Marco Polo
  • Heather Emmanuel (Girl) was Tessa in The Android Invasion (4)
  • Anthony Lang (Sick man) was an Egyptian Slave in The Daleks' Master PlanExtra in The Highlanders (1) and The Faceless Ones (1), Time Lord in The Three Doctors (1), and Kaled Councillor in Genesis of the Daleks
  • Byron [Richard] Sotiris (Man) was Critas in Enlightenment (2)
  • Richard Atherton (Man) was Lama in The Abominable Snowmen, Inspector/Prison Officer in The Mind of Evil, Noble in The Androids of Tara, and Passenger in Time Flight
